Home construction is a significant endeavor that involves intricate planning, budgeting, and execution (Landscape improvement services offered Northridge, CA). Understanding the house construction timeline is essential for owners to manage their expectations and coordinate varied elements of the build. Such a timeline encompasses everything from the preliminary design section to the ultimate walkthrough before moving in
The foundation of any residence construction timeline begins with the planning phase. This stage includes defining the imaginative and prescient for the home, together with layouts, kinds, and features. Engaging an architect or designer is commonly on the forefront, as they translate the homeowner's ideas into actionable blueprints. This collaborative process can take a quantity of weeks, relying on the complexity of the design and the number of revisions required.
Once the plans are finalized, securing financing becomes the subsequent essential step. Homeowners must explore varied financing choices, from conventional mortgages to construction loans. Lenders will typically require detailed project estimates and timelines to assess the project's viability. This phase is significant because acquiring financing can dramatically affect the project schedule, often adding several weeks to the timeline.
After securing financing, the development permits need to be obtained. The permit course of can differ significantly between completely different municipalities and may often be a major source of delays. Homeowners should navigate local building codes, zoning laws, and regulatory necessities. This side of the house construction timeline can take wherever from a few days to a quantity of months, depending on native rules and the completeness of the submitted documentation.

When permits are issued, the site preparation can start. This part usually consists of duties like clearing and grading the land, digging trenches for utilities, and establishing needed infrastructure. Depending on the site’s situation and climate, this preparation can take a few days to a quantity of weeks. Site preparation is foundational, because it units the stage for the construction that follows.
Once the positioning is prepared, the precise construction part begins. This is where the house starts to take form, beginning with the foundation. The sort of foundation will rely upon the home design, soil conditions, and local weather. The foundation section can last a couple of weeks, because it requires cautious engineering and should treatment correctly to make sure stability.
Following the inspiration work, framing is the following important step in the residence construction timeline. During this part, the fundamental construction of the home is constructed, including partitions, flooring, and roofs. This is usually a extremely seen and exciting part of the project, because it gives a physical form to the house (Quality Remodeling general contractor Van Nuys, CA). Framing can take a number of weeks to finish, relying on the dimensions and complexity of the design
Once the framing is up, it is time to install the roofing and exterior elements. This contains adding home windows, doors, and any exterior finishing materials like siding or brick. These external components are crucial for shielding the home from the elements and ensuring energy efficiency. The roofing and exterior installation can also take a few weeks.

With the house's shell complete, interior work can begin. This stage includes plumbing, electrical work, and HVAC set up. All these essential methods must be installed before drywall can go up. Each of these tasks requires skilled labor and careful scheduling, as each step relies on the earlier one being full. This part can considerably influence the home construction timeline, often taking a number of weeks to greater than a month.
Once the essential systems are in place, insulation and drywall installation comply with. Insulation is essential for energy efficiency and comfort, whereas drywall provides the home its completed interior look. The means of hanging, taping, and finishing drywall may be labor-intensive and requires precision. It is a vital step that may additionally take weeks to make sure everything is seamless and prepared for ending touches.
As the interior takes form, the finishing section begins, encompassing painting, flooring set up, cabinetry, and fixtures. This part of the timeline is where the house transforms into a house, with personal touches being added all through. Selecting these finishes and making certain they arrive on time could be a problem, typically leading to delays if there are supply chain points or backorders.

Final inspections and walk-throughs kind the concluding part of the home construction timeline. Before the house owner can transfer in, native building inspectors should verify that everything adheres to the mandatory codes and regulations. The final walk-through also allows householders to determine any issues or omissions that need to be addressed. This step is crucial for ensuring that the house is safe and prepared for occupancy.

The typical phases of a house construction timeline embody site preparation, foundation work, framing, roofing, plumbing and electrical work, interior finishes, and last inspections. Each part can differ in length primarily based on project size, complexity, and weather situations.
How lengthy does it usually take to construct a home?
On common, building a house can take wherever from 6 months to over a year. Factors influencing the timeline embody the design complexity, native laws, availability of materials, and the efficiency of the construction crews.

What may cause delays in the construction timeline?
Common causes of delays in construction timelines embrace surprising climate circumstances, changes in design plans, delays in permits and inspections, material shortages, and labor points (Building Contractors reviewed Studio City, CA). Staying proactive with communication can help mitigate a few of these delays
How can I ensure my home construction stays on schedule?
To hold your home construction on schedule, maintain clear communication with your contractor, set realistic timelines based in your project’s specifics, and often evaluation progress. Having contingency plans in place can also help tackle potential delays promptly.
